Report: Adam Neumann’s Flow raises $100M+, more than doubles valuation to $2.5B

Former WeWork CEO Adam Neumann has raised over $100 million in capital for his proptech startup, Flow, in a round that values that company at about $2.5 billion, Bloomberg reported on Thursday. Citing anonymous sources familiar with the deal, Bloomberg reported that existing backer Andreessen Horowitz (a16z) participated in the financing. Neumann told Bloomberg that […]

Revolut, the $45B neobank, posts $1B profit in 2024

Revolut, the $45 billion neobanking startup founded in the U.K., may have put its IPO plans on ice, but its balance sheet is looking pretty hot. The company reported net profit of $1 billion (790 million) in 2024, while its customer base grew by 38% to 52.5 million, according to its annual report. Revenues increased […]
